German railroads roll on concrete
German Federal Railroads use concrete ties for strength and long range economy; two or four ribbed steel rods to each tie; rib reinforcements are about 2-in. apart, protruding from rod about 3-mm and are claimed to provide complete bonding of steel reinforcement and concrete; pressure resistance of 1200 lb per sq cm obtained.
